On Board Diagnostics (OBD) Systems are used in many cars. These computer interfaces can be a wonderful method to check the condition of nearly every type of car. A scanner is required to conduct a diagnostic test. It is connected to the connector located under the driver's side dashboard. The scanner will capture an error from the car's computer . This will give a mechanic an idea of the issue.

Problem areas

The modern automobile is highly computerized and features a variety of sensors throughout the engine. The diagnostic tool generates an error code for any part of the vehicle which is experiencing issues. These codes are a signal to the specific system that needs to be fixed or repaired. The diagnostic tool will quickly identify the problematic areas.

Codes that indicate problem areas

Auto mechanics can use trouble codes to determine and fix issues with their vehicles. Certain trouble codes are crucial and need immediate attention. Some codes indicate more serious problems that could be a threat for the passenger and driver. Certain codes are linked to specific systems, like the engine emissions system and others do not.

DTCs are generated from the On-Board bmw diagnostics software I systems. These systems track major components and relay problem codes. Knowing these codes is essential in reducing the amount of time a vehicle is down. The car's manufacturer provides an established list of DTCs to help identify problems and determine the kind of vehicle.

Diagnostic trouble codes are five-character strings that inform mechanics where the issue is located in the vehicle. They can be used to diagnose and repair vehicle issues either electrical or mechanical. Some are temporary, while some are permanent. Some codes will only appear in response to certain actions. Some codes will not impact your car while other will require immediate attention from an expert mechanic.

The most popular method of reading codes is using an OBD-II scanner. These devices connect to the diagnostic port of your vehicle and provide the user with the required information. Some come with software to interpret codes. Although they're more expensive than scanners, code readers have the same functionality however they aren't as effective.

Diagnostic tools

Car diagnostic tools are able to help identify vehicle problems. While warning lights may be a sign of serious problems, a tool can detect the problem before it has an impact on the vehicle's performance. These tools can also be used to investigate the vehicle's systems and provide more detailed analytics. They should be readily available in every auto repair shop.

A code reader is one of the most basic tools. The device scans your car's computer to identify any codes and display them. You may be able to clear the codes to determine if the repair was successful. Certain of these tools allow you to customize your own list of parameters IDs.

Another kind of car diagnostic tool is the scope. It can test a wide variety of parts and components. The scope is also able to read signals from sensors or other parts of the car. Diagnostic tools for automotive cost a lot, but they help mechanics to diagnose a car quickly.

Code readers are another important diagnostic tool. These devices are connected to the OBD-II port on an automobile. These devices are useful for diagnosing problems with check engine warning lights. These tools provide potential error codes, which help to identify the causes. These ports are available on the majority of vehicles manufactured after 1997, however they are not required on imported vehicles or luxury vehicles.

Diagnostic tests can be expensive.

The cost of car diagnostic tests is dependent on several factors. The factors that determine the cost include the type and make of the vehicle and any issues that could arise. Some tests are more expensive than others, and it is important to take into consideration your budget before selecting a particular mechanic. A basic car diagnostic test is usually less than $60, however, more sophisticated tests can cost up to hundreds of dollars.

A car diagnostic test can help you identify the issues your car is having, and what must be done to resolve those issues. By addressing the issue early you can avoid costly repairs down the road. You should always get an auto diagnostic test whenever you find that your car is showing any of these problems.

Although you may be reluctant to invest in diagnostic testing, it will reduce stress and money. The process of having your car examined is worthwhile as it can prevent expensive repairs like brake repairs, rim repairs, or custom body work. A diagnostic test may help you determine the root cause of the issue and help you find the solution.

A diagnostic test is a quick and easy way to identify the root of a malfunction in your car. The procedure can be done by an auto diagnostics near me mechanic or part store for a small cost. It could cost anything between $55 and $150 dependent on the nature of issue and the mechanic.
